Nollywood director, and film maker, Austin Faani Ikechukwu, who happens to be the husband to Nollywood actress, Charity Eke has broken silence, following his wife’s decision to call it quits in their marriage.
Recall that ChaCha, as she’s widely known took to her Instagram page 24 hours ago, Monday, June 27 to announce that she’s finally separating from her husband, after second time in two years she’s complaining about her marriage.
However, taking to his Instagram page hours later, Mr Faani noted that he’s not a violent person and he personally detest violence in any form.
He further mentioned that he had never raised his hands on any woman in his life, including his wife Charity, adding that everyone close to their family knows the absolute truth.
Austin therefore noted that it’s not in his place to divulge the case, but he’s very certain that the person who started the rumour about him being a wife abuser will in due time continue to talk.
He wrote, “I am not a violent person. Personally, I detest violence in any form. I have never raised my hand on any woman in my life including my wife.
“Everyone close to this case knows the absolute truth and it is not in my place to divulge it, the one person who started the talk will in due time continue to talk. Let Light lead. – Austin Faani (dated: 28 June 2022 at 21:23)”
Chacha had noted in her statement that she doesn’t want to die or go inexplicably missing, and it’s either she leaves her marriage now alive or she leaves as a corpse. She also apologized to the general public for living a lie all these years in her marriage.
The actress also confirmed that she has relentlessly being on the stand that she and Austin should go their separate ways, adding that the second time in two years she’s coming out to announce her decision to divorce him.
Recall in October 2020, Chacha took to social media to share a video announcing the end of her marriage to her movie director husband.
However, a few days later, she shared another video from a hospital bed disclosing that she had been diagnosed with “Bipolar disorder”, while debunking allegations that her marriage ended due to domestic violence.
Chacha and Mr Austin Faani Ikechukwu have been married for 9 years and share four children together.
